Here is a good checklist of items you should have for your baby’s bath: 1. A good infant bathtub. 2. Washclothes or sponges. 3. Some mild baby shampoo. 4. Soft towels. For your baby I would recommend you use all natural products and products which are mild and gentle on baby’s skin. All baby’s skin is sensitive so you need to take care when using any products on him or her.
You can buy whats known as a baby sling bath if you think it might help you. It will help keep your baby safe while giving him or her a bath. A baby sling will stop your baby from slipping and banging their head while you are bathing them. Babies will wriggle alot once in the water especially when you apply soap to them so a baby sling can be really useful.
The first time you have to give your baby a bath can be a nerve racking one. It’s to be expected as you have never had to do this before. many parents make mistakes the first time they bath the baby and this can be uncomfortable for the baby and the parents. To avoid this you could ask someone who has experience to show you how it’s done or to come to your home and watch while you are doing it. The nurses in the hospital will often show new moms how to bath their baby or a midwife at a home birth.
Giving your baby a bath is a wonderful experience and you will become an expert in time. To start just take it slowly and don’t try and do anything too quickly. Have a second person around in case you need support or a helping hand. And remember above all enjoy the experience, you know your baby will!
